Neighborhood Overview
Eucalyptus Hill / Westmont College is a rural neighborhood in Santa Barbara, CA, known for its peaceful, retiree-friendly character.
Housing is mostly older single-family homes and apartments, with a mix of owners and renters and low vacancy.
Quick Facts
| Retiree-Friendly | Top 1.5% in California |
|---|
Housing market and real estate character
The neighborhood features medium to small single-family homes and apartments, with a balanced owner and renter mix and low vacancy.
| Vacancy Rate | 3.8 |
|---|---|
| Housing Age | Many built 1940-1969; some 1970-1999 |
| Housing Type | Medium to small single-family homes and apartments |

Commute Patterns
Most residents have short commutes and primarily drive alone, with some walking and carpooling.
Short commutes and car use reflect a suburban lifestyle with convenient access to work.
| Under 15 Minute Commute | 57.2% |
|---|---|
| Drive Alone | 61.0% |
| Walk to Work | 8.1% |
| Carpool | 6.7% |
